my bug will stop running after i drive my bug a bit then it will not turn over and start but if i wait awhile then try it starts up, would it be my coil, cuz it was really hot today when i was looking at it.

Jeff:

The coil will not have any impact on the car turning over.  This will be the starter circuit.

It sound to me like you have a hard start or hot start problem.  Do you have a Hard Start Relay installed? The problem is due to the peculiar nature of the VW wiring where the battery is not near the engine compartment. Current to start the car must go from the battery all the way to the ignition switch and then back to the starter. Its a long run of wire compared to what you would typically see in a car with the engine and battery mounted in the front of the car.

Over time, as the wire ages and electrical contacts become corroded, resistance builds in the wire. This is magnified in a hot climate where heat further increases the resistance. As I recall, the problem first appeared in California years ago as a result of the warm climate (and probably also a high concentration of VWs). It is further magnified by the air cooled design of the vintage VW engine where there is no liquid cooling system. The starter is tucked way up by the engine/transmission and can act like a heat sink.

Putting in a relay helps to solve the problem as the relay acts like a switch and the starting current does not have to travel all the way forward and all the way back. Its right there via the short run from the battery.
